Transaction 50fa58d51a15036675341e85e06ce4046fd95d562e79c1f5db0e88f789c458a3
1 Input
1 Output
-
50fa58d51a15036675341e85e06ce4046fd95d562e79c1f5db0e88f789c458a3:0
- value
- 17089288
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bb7873aaf0f17d0fdb6e7fff37bd77608a0bc06
- address
- bc1qhwmcww40putapldkulllx77hwcy2p0qx5x8sw2